About this audiobook
Have you ever wondered how great musicians get that way? Would you like to get more practicing done in less time and grow your talent to the highest level possible? Berklee-degreed, thirty-year veteran musician/instructor Stan Munslow has culled together six powerful, proven practice strategies used by the world’s top players that will give you a lifetime of life-smarts that will save you countless hours of time and effort no matter what style of music you play or what level you’re at. Even school band musicians will benefit from these easy-to-follow techniques. In less than a half-hour you will learn more about effective practicing than anyone you know!
